BACKGROUND: Identifying factors that can influence young peoples' physical activity and sedentary behaviors is important for the development of effective interventions. The family structure in which children grow up may be one such factor. As the prevalence of single parent and reconstituted families have increased substantially over the last decades, the objective of this study was to examine whether these family structures are differentially associated with young people's MVPA, participation in organized sports and screen-time activities (screen-based passive entertainment, gaming, other screen-based activities) as compared to traditional nuclear families.Entities:

Baseline characteristics
| Variable | Estimate |
|---|---|
| Female sex, % (n) | 52.8 (2381) |
| Age category, % (n) | |
| 11 yrs. old | 30.2 (1353) |
| 13 yrs. old | 23.0 (1030) |
| 15 yrs. old | 19.4 (869) |
| 16 yrs. old | 27.3 (1223) |
| Material affluence, % (n) | |
| Low | 18.3 (783) |
| Middle | 65.5 (2809) |
| High | 16.2 (696) |
| Having siblings, % (n) | 90.9 (3652) |
| BMI, mean (SD) | 19.7 (3.5) |
| Family structure, % (n) | |
| Both parents | 74.1 (2962) |
| Single parent | 15.7 (628) |
| Reconstituted | 10.2 (407) |
| 60 min MVPA in days, mean (SD) | 4.1 (2.0) |
| Less than 7 days 60 min MVPA, % (n) | 82.8 (3507) |
| Not participating in organized sport, % (n) | 38.2 (1051) |
| Screen-based passive entertainment (hours/day), mean (SD) | 2.1 (1.6) |
| Gaming in hours/day, mean (SD) | 1.7 (1.8) |
| Other screen-based activities in hours/day, mean (SD) | 2.4 (2.0) |
| Total screen time in hours/day, mean (SD) | 6.1 (4.3) |
| Screen time > 2 h/day, % (n) | 83.6 (2935) |
